Subject: Badge system migration — action for reception

Hi all,

From Monday, Varlent House switches from the old Kestrel badge readers to the new Ambervale system. Existing staff badges will stop working at the turnstiles at 08:00. Reception will issue temporary passes to anyone whose new badge hasn't arrived; the printer behind the desk is already loaded with the new stock. Log every temporary pass in the ledger as usual. Until the changeover completes, the interim door code for the staff entrance is below.

turnstile pass: bdg-FVNQRS-72965873

### Runbook: Report export timezone mismatches (Glimmerfield)

If a customer reports that exported totals differ from the dashboard, check whether their report schedule predates the March cutover — older schedules still render in server-local time rather than the account timezone. Re-saving the schedule fixes it. Before escalating, confirm the export worker is running with the expected timezone settings shown below.

config for kadup-kajog:
[raldor]
host = raldor.tolvaqworks.internal
user = raldor_svc
database = raldor_prod

**Alert: PriceExperimentDrift — Stubhatch.** The Meadowgate ticket-pricing experiment is serving variant prices to users outside the assigned cohort. Assignment hashing changed in last week's refactor of the Stubhatch bucketing library; salt mismatch is the likely cause. Experiment results since the deploy are unusable and should be flagged. Kill switch is available; flipping it reverts everyone to control pricing. Cohort definitions, salt history, and the remediation checklist live on the page below.

wiki page, hahif-hahif: https://argocd.kelvisys.corp/browse/board/settings/pages/1442e0b1065d83f1

TURN-208: Gatevale turnstile counters at the Merrow Field pilot double-count when a rotation reverses mid-cycle. Attendance totals drift roughly 2% high per event. The debounce window fix is implemented, reviewed by Ilsa, and soak-tested across two simulated match days without drift. Ready for your cut; the candidate build is identified below.

trace token, tagag-tafog: htk6_5ed18c